The USMC 1909 New Service .45 is quite scarce, only about 1300 made. Most of those were given to our friends in Hati and Cuba when the 1911 auto was adopted.
Condition is everything. Blue Book shows a tremendous range of dollar values depending on the amount of ORIGINAL finish remaining.
